Transaction 6593c663b282003d5a346b39d20389fe8382e9cd2863c5b5f93ea60ecdf48c46

1 Input
2 Outputs
  • 6593c663b282003d5a346b39d20389fe8382e9cd2863c5b5f93ea60ecdf48c46:0
  • value  156920472
    address  1HFWUD2ZvHbshhrA6LAvQT4JYUreuXGgLL
  • 6593c663b282003d5a346b39d20389fe8382e9cd2863c5b5f93ea60ecdf48c46:1
  • value  6685959
    address  1GUGsCtKy6LZLrV2utm6NqnjEjaCYo3cid